Coen Brothers, Dispelling the Myth of “Clean” Coal
March
2nd
The Coen Brothers have taken their unique view of the world and applied it to the myth of “clean” coal, directing a commercial spoof that seeks to dispel the fantasy of guilt-free fossil fuels as wishful thinking at best. The spot was created on behalf of the Reality Coalition, a non-profit project comprised of various environmental groups that challenge the coal industry’s claims that such an energy source exists, demanding they transform their operations and end their current advertising campaign.
